AU$12,000 - Entries close 21 August
Based in the port city of Fremantle in Western Australia, the Fremantle International Portrait Prize is the fastest growing photographic competition in Australia. FiPP ran for the first time in 2012 and adheres to the highest egalitarian and ethical standards.
FiPP is open to ALL photographers, amateur or professional, anywhere in the world. FiPP is run by a team of nine volunteers with all profits
going to charity - the Arthritis and Osteoporosis Foundation of Western Australia. The judging system is innovative, creating the most statistically rreliable and valid system of any competition worldwide.
